The Master’s Conference brings together leading experts and professionals from law firms, corporations and the bench to develop strategies, practices and resources for managing eDiscovery and the information life cycle.  This year’s Washington DC event covers topics ranging from privacy to cybersecurity to predictive coding and AI, among other things.
